SSophia HackerI stayed at the Hotel Les Capitouls and was overall satisfied with my experience. The location is excellent — very central and perfect for exploring Toulouse on foot. The breakfast was also a real highlight, with a great selection and high quality.
On the downside, the rooms were quite noisy, with little sound insulation, and street noise was noticeable, especially at night. Additionally, one of the receptionists was somewhat unfriendly, which was a bit disappointing for a hotel of this standard.
In summary: great location and breakfast, but room for improvement in service and soundproofing.
